Raul Rivero strike sinks Chicago Fire

Vancouver Whitecaps snatch victory at Chicago Fire thanks to Raul Rivero's late strike at Toyota Park.

Raul Rivero's late strike earned Vancouver Whitecaps their first win of the MLS season away to Chicago Fire.

The hosts almost found a breakthrough on 24 minutes when Joevin Jones was denied by keeper David Ousted.

Ousted needed to be on his mettle again before the break when Harrison Shipp latched onto Michael Stephens' pass, but saw his effort saved by the busy Vancouver stopper.

Not to be outdone, Fire keeper Jon Busch was called into action to thwart Kekuta Manneh as the teams reached the interval on level terms.

Both sides had chances to break the deadlock at Toyota Park, with Nicolas Mezquida firing wide from close range and Quincy Amarikwa seeing his second-half strike stopped by Ousted.

However, Vancouver snatched a 1-0 victory in the dying minutes when Rivero diverted Steven Beitashour ball beyond the reach of a helpless Busch.
